Output bbd59d72dae55ab4a58bdbac7df3dfc4a9f2af7907586d5460728da244c2022e:8

value
2670364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bfc8628e129bcb10699745f12d2450661a18dfb OP_EQUALVERIFY OP_CHECKSIG
address
13YykrozCeqpXkSnWbioBoPff5sVJ7etYg
transaction
bbd59d72dae55ab4a58bdbac7df3dfc4a9f2af7907586d5460728da244c2022e
spent
true